Pravdepodobnosť kolízie hash 256 bitov

2101

Hašovacia funkcia MD5 SHA-1 SHA-256 SHA-512 Počet bitov 128 160 256 512 2.4 Jednosmernosť a bezkolízovosť Hašovacia funkcia musí byť jednosmerná a bezkolizná [12]. Jednosmerná znamená, ţe z M sa dá vypočítať h(M), ale obrátene je to výpočtovo nemoţné v rozumnom čase.

Ako už z názvu vyplýva, SHA-256 prijíma údaje a vracia hash, ktorý je dlhý 256 bitov alebo 64 znakov. Okrem zabezpečenia ochrany záznamov o transakciách v účtovných knihách hrá kryptografia tiež úlohu pri zaisťovaní bezpečnosti peňaženiek používaných na ukladanie jednotiek kryptomien. •Secure Hash Algorithm 1 (NSA 1995 pre DSS) •160 bitov pre 512 bitové bloky •padding ako MD5 (max 264 b) •4 rundy po 20 operáciách •32 bitové súčty •2.2017 - záe kolíze útoky (263 výpočtov ̴ 110 rokov GPU) Zi vý seester 2020 Hašovacie fu vkcie 8 Implementácia (14) zvyšuje hodnotu δ podľa (3). Teraz sa už δ = 64, čo znižuje pravdepodobnosť cache kolízií. Pre δ = 16 je pravdepodobnosť cache miss 40,51%, zatiaľ čo pre δ = 64 je to len 1,78%.

Pravdepodobnosť kolízie hash 256 bitov

  1. Predikcia ceny bnb
  2. Ron kim twitter
  3. Previesť bitcoin z hotovostnej aplikácie do výplaty
  4. Ako overiť účet gmail bez hesla -

Pri£om okom beºného £loveak a v nemálo prípadoch aj okom informatikov zostanú nepov²imnuté. Dlho som neváhal, ke¤ mi pán docent Olejár navrhol tému útokov na ne. i uº z h©adiska … Kryptoanalýza šifier v mobilných sieťach. RNDr. Rastislav Krivoš-Belluš, PhD. Bc. Ján Kotrady.

vstup nemá poºadoanvú d¨ºku a je ºiadané doplnenie nieko©kých bitov vhodným spôsobom (napríklad bitmi 0) na získanie bloku poºadoanejv d¨ºky. enTto proces nazývame addingp . 2.1.4 valancAhe e ect Vítanýmjavomjeajtzv. lavínový efekt ( avalanche e ect ), kedyajmalá

Pravdepodobnosť kolízie hash 256 bitov

rámca nastala kolízia 1 bit, 2 m odoslaných 510 bitov, detekujeme kolíziu rámec nie je úspešne odoslaný! odoslaná polovica min. rámca = 256 bitov detekcia kolízie, koniec odosielania SHA (Secure Hash Algorithm) je rozšířená hašovací funkce, která vytváří ze vstupních dat výstup (otisk) fixní délky.Otisk je též označován jako miniatura, kontrolní součet (v zásadě nesprávné označení), fingerprint, hash (česky někdy psán i jako haš). Hašovacia funkcia je funkcia (predpis) pre prevod vstupného reťazca dát na krátky výstupný reťazec.

Pokracovanie: Hladanie kolizie je o tom, ze chcem najst nejake dve spravy, ktore maju rovnaky hash. To je riziko hlavne u prenosu sifrovanej spravy, kde je podpisany hash - tak by mohol niekto na zaklade toho, ze da niekomu podpisat nieco jemu zname napriklad vymysliet iny text, ktory ma rovnaky hash a teda nan sedi podpis.

Okrem zabezpečenia ochrany záznamov o transakciách v účtovných knihách hrá kryptografia tiež úlohu pri zaisťovaní bezpečnosti peňaženiek používaných na ukladanie jednotiek kryptomien. Implementácia (14) zvyšuje hodnotu δ podľa (3).

Pravdepodobnosť kolízie hash 256 bitov

SHA-1 produkuje hodnotu hash 160 bitov. V roku 2002 NIST vypracoval revidovanú verziu normy FIPS 180-2, ktorá definovala tri nové verzie SHA s dĺžkou hešovej hodnoty 256, 384 a 512 bitov, známych ako SHA-256, SHA-384 a SHA-512.

hash), charakteristika, odtlačok vstupných dát. Ako už z názvu vyplýva, SHA-256 prijíma údaje a vracia hash, ktorý je dlhý 256 bitov alebo 64 znakov. Okrem zabezpečenia ochrany záznamov o transakciách v účtovných knihách hrá kryptografia tiež úlohu pri zaisťovaní bezpečnosti peňaženiek používaných na ukladanie jednotiek kryptomien. Kolízie hašu sa vo všeobecnosti riešia určitou formou metódy lineárnych pokusov, takže ak hašovacia funkcia zvykne vracať podobné hodnoty, výsledkom bude pomalé vyhľadávanie. Ideálna hašovacia funkcia by pri každej zmene jednotlivého bitu kľúča (vrátane rozšírenia a skrátenia kľúča) zmenila polovicu bitov hašu a dĺžok a to 128 bitov, 160 bitov, 192 bitov, 224 bitov a 256 bitov.

Implementáciu dokladu o práci v našej sieti s časovou pečiatkou vykonáme pripočítaním tzv. Ako už z názvu vyplýva, SHA-256 prijíma údaje a vracia hash, ktorý je dlhý 256 bitov alebo 64 znakov. Okrem zabezpečenia ochrany záznamov o transakciách v účtovných knihách hrá kryptografia tiež úlohu pri zaisťovaní bezpečnosti peňaženiek používaných na ukladanie jednotiek kryptomien. Implementácia (14) zvyšuje hodnotu δ podľa (3). Teraz sa už δ = 64, čo znižuje pravdepodobnosť cache kolízií. Pre δ = 16 je pravdepodobnosť cache miss 40,51%, zatiaľ čo pre δ = 64 je to len 1,78%. [1, str.

Rastislav Krivoš-Belluš, PhD. Bc. Ján Kotrady. 07:00 Je ustanovený jeho nástupca Advanced Encryption Standard (AES), 128 bitový šifrátor s 128 alebo 192 alebo 256 bitovým kľúčom V súčasnosti sa na zvýšenie kryptografickej sily používa verzia TripleDES (64 bitový šifrátor so 112 bitovým kľúčom, pri šifrovaní: prvým kľúčom sa šifruje, druhým sa dešifruje a prvým sa opäť šifruje, pri dešifrovaní: prvým kľúčom sa dešifruje, druhým sa šifruje a prvým sa opäť dešifruje) … 2 8 = 256. 2 12 = 4096. 2 16 = 65536. Tab. 1 Tabuľka najpoužívanejších mocnín 2.

Bajtovo orientovaná XOR je sčítanie polynómov. Additive RNG, slov.

status objednávky objektívov uzavretý význam
cena bittrex btc
je čas rafiki gif
top 3 lacné akcie, ktoré si teraz môžete kúpiť
cena akcie alg

SHA256 online hash function.

Napríklad algoritmus SHA-256 môže produkovať iba výstupy 256 bitov, zatiaľ čo SHA-1 bude vždy generovať 160-bitový digest. Na ilustráciu spustíme slová „Bitcoin“ a „bitcoin“ prostredníctvom hashovacieho algoritmu SHA-256 (algoritmu používaného v Bitcoine): SHA-256. Vstup 10/03/2017 Hashovanie sa využíva aj v konsenzuálnych algoritmoch používaných na validáciu transakcií. Napríklad na bitcoinovom blockchaine využíva algoritmus Proof of Work (PoW) hashovaciu funkciu nazvanú SHA-256. Ako už z názvu vyplýva, SHA-256 prijíma údaje a vracia hash, ktorý je dlhý 256 bitov alebo 64 znakov. 255 bitov, 510 m odoslaná skoro polovica min.

Zjednodušený príklad: Veľkosťelektronických údajov 2Byte (2^16 bitov = 65536 informácií) a veľkosťhash hodnoty 1Byte (2^8 bitov = 256 informácií) potom iba 256 priradení je jednoznačných a máme 65536 – 256 = 65280 kolízií. Pri skutočnej veľkosti hash hodnoty je to analogické.

07:00 Je ustanovený jeho nástupca Advanced Encryption Standard (AES), 128 bitový šifrátor s 128 alebo 192 alebo 256 bitovým kľúčom V súčasnosti sa na zvýšenie kryptografickej sily používa verzia TripleDES (64 bitový šifrátor so 112 bitovým kľúčom, pri šifrovaní: prvým kľúčom sa šifruje, druhým sa dešifruje a prvým sa opäť šifruje, pri dešifrovaní: prvým kľúčom sa dešifruje, druhým sa šifruje a prvým sa opäť dešifruje) … 2 8 = 256. 2 12 = 4096.

Adresy triedy B dávajú pre identifikáciu počítača v sieti k dispozícii 16 bitov a sú určené pre siete majúce medzi 256 a 65355 pripojenými počítačmi. Konečne, trieda C slúži pre adresáciu v malých sieťach s menej než 256 pripojenými počítačmi. Pre zápis internetovských adries sa používa typická notácia, jednotlivé slabiky adresy, zapísané ako dekadické čísla, sú oddelené bodkami. Takéto hašovanie nám so sebou prináša obrovské požiadavky na pamät.